| 24 | /*
|
|---|
| 25 | handle operational attributes
|
|---|
| 26 | */
|
|---|
| 27 |
|
|---|
| 28 | /*
|
|---|
| 29 | createTimestamp: HIDDEN, searchable, ldaptime, alias for whenCreated
|
|---|
| 30 | modifyTimestamp: HIDDEN, searchable, ldaptime, alias for whenChanged
|
|---|
| 31 |
|
|---|
| 32 | for the above two, we do the search as normal, and if
|
|---|
| 33 | createTimestamp or modifyTimestamp is asked for, then do
|
|---|
| 34 | additional searches for whenCreated and whenChanged and fill in
|
|---|
| 35 | the resulting values
|
|---|
| 36 |
|
|---|
| 37 | we also need to replace these with the whenCreated/whenChanged
|
|---|
| 38 | equivalent in the search expression trees
|
|---|
| 39 |
|
|---|
| 40 | whenCreated: not-HIDDEN, CONSTRUCTED, SEARCHABLE
|
|---|
| 41 | whenChanged: not-HIDDEN, CONSTRUCTED, SEARCHABLE
|
|---|
| 42 |
|
|---|
| 43 | on init we need to setup attribute handlers for these so
|
|---|
| 44 | comparisons are done correctly. The resolution is 1 second.
|
|---|
| 45 |
|
|---|
| 46 | on add we need to add both the above, for current time
|
|---|
| 47 |
|
|---|
| 48 | on modify we need to change whenChanged
|
|---|
| 49 |
|
|---|
| 50 |
|
|---|
| 51 | subschemaSubentry: HIDDEN, not-searchable,
|
|---|
| 52 | points at DN CN=Aggregate,CN=Schema,CN=Configuration,$BASEDN
|
|---|
| 53 |
|
|---|
| 54 | for this one we do the search as normal, then add the static
|
|---|
| 55 | value if requested. How do we work out the $BASEDN from inside a
|
|---|
| 56 | module?
|
|---|
| 57 |
|
|---|
| 58 |
|
|---|
| 59 | structuralObjectClass: HIDDEN, CONSTRUCTED, not-searchable. always same as objectclass?
|
|---|
| 60 |
|
|---|
| 61 | for this one we do the search as normal, then if requested ask
|
|---|
| 62 | for objectclass, change the attribute name, and add it
|
|---|
| 63 |
|
|---|
| 64 | allowedAttributesEffective: HIDDEN, CONSTRUCTED, not-searchable,
|
|---|
| 65 | list of attributes that can be modified - requires schema lookup
|
|---|
| 66 |
|
|---|
| 67 |
|
|---|
| 68 | attributeTypes: in schema only
|
|---|
| 69 | objectClasses: in schema only
|
|---|
| 70 | matchingRules: in schema only
|
|---|
| 71 | matchingRuleUse: in schema only
|
|---|
| 72 | creatorsName: not supported by w2k3?
|
|---|
| 73 | modifiersName: not supported by w2k3?
|
|---|
| 74 | */
